Computing·Artificial Intelligence·conceptual

AI Mistakes and Limitations

Machines make mistakes; they only know what they've been shown; bad training data leads to bad results; AI is not magic — just maths on data; showing edge cases and failures

Suggested ages 7–9

Open direct link

Evidence of understanding

  • Give an example of AI making a mistake (voice assistant mishearing, auto-correct error, wrong recommendation)
  • Explain that AI mistakes happen because of gaps or errors in training data
  • Describe why AI is not magic — it follows mathematical rules applied to data

Assessment prompt

If an AI incorrectly identified a picture of a muffin as a chihuahua, could AI Mistakes and Limitations explain why that kind of mistake happens?
